Liberal MP Rodger Cuzner (Cape Breton–Canso, N.S.) announced a total of $545,000 in non-repayable contributions for two projects at the Waycobah First Nation to expand its trout growing operation and upgrade its processing facility. The funding is being made through ACOA’s Business Development Program. Liberal MP Rodger Cuzner (Cape Breton–Canso, N.S.) announced more than $730,000 for four projects in Cape Breton. More than $525,000 in repayable contributions will enable the Dundee Resort & Golf Club and MacLeod’s Beach – Campsite to renew aging infrastructure. And $205,000 will go toward projects at the Inverness Development Association and the Société Mi-Carême. On behalf of Innovation, Science and Economic Development Minister Navdeep Bains (Mississauga-Malton, Ont.), Liberal MP Bernadette Jordan (South Shore – St. Margarets, N.S.) announced the Government of Canada is investing $61,500 in Terra Beata Farms to help the rural Nova Scotia cranberry producer double its production capacity for pure juice and expand into additional retail locations across Canada. The Cities of New Brunswick Association will help municipalities develop and implement “smart” technology solutions to address the challenges of today and create opportunities for tomorrow. As part of this initiative, the CNBA will develop a survey to increase awareness of smart community solutions and gain insight into the needs and challenges that municipalities face. Liberal MP Bernadette Jordan (South Shore–St. Margaret’s, N.S.) announced a $150,000 contribution to the Liverpool Championship Host Society to help the organization host the 2019 World Junior Curling Championships.
